American Android wins NASA 2001 SBIR Phase I funding

Princeton, New Jersey - September 11, 2001 - American Android Corp. has been selected to receive NASA Small Business Innovation Research (SBIR) Phase I funding for a project entitled "In-Situ Training of Anthropomorphic Robots." The research contract will be with NASA Johnson Space Center and will be overseen by JSC's Robot Systems Technology Branch.

The six month feasibility study will demonstrate how existing proprietary robotics and artificial intelligence technology can be applied to the problem of in-the-field training of machines by human operators. The goal is to enable EVA astronauts to verbally customize the behavior of humanoid robots.
